How they compare

Cuba currently reports 89.2% against 80.2% in WB: Caribbean Small States, a difference of 9.0%.

That makes Cuba's figure about 1.1 times WB: Caribbean Small States's.

The two have swapped places 7 times across 53 shared years of data; in 1971 it was WB: Caribbean Small States ahead.

Cuba ranks 97th and WB: Caribbean Small States ranks 98th of 192 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Cuba averaged higher in 4 and WB: Caribbean Small States in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Cuba WB: Caribbean Small States Difference Ahead
1970s 24.0% 65.0% 41.1% WB: Caribbean Small States
1980s 78.8% 77.6% 1.2% Cuba
1990s 80.8% 80.9% 0.1% WB: Caribbean Small States
2000s 92.5% 83.1% 9.4% Cuba
2010s 90.7% 83.0% 7.8% Cuba
2020s 89.4% 79.5% 9.9% Cuba

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
